BREAKING: Mass Shooting Suspect Shot And Killed By Armed Citizen At Mall Food Court; 3 Dead And 2 Injured
5Posted By
Update 7/17/2022 @ 11:39 PM EST During a press conference, Greenwood Police Department Chief Jim Ison stated that a 22-year-old, legally armed with a handgun, observed and then shot and killed the suspect. The 22-year-old was not identified, but is from Bartholomew County, roughly 35 miles from the mall. Update 7/17/2022 @ 09:46 PM EST…

Dick Heller Files Lawsuit That Challenges Washington DC’s Limit On The Number Of Rounds An Armed Citizen Can Carry
1Posted By
Dick Heller, of District of Columbia v. Heller fame, has filed a lawsuit that aims to challenge Washington, DC’s current restrictions on concealed carry, specifically their limits to the amount of rounds a concealed carrier can have on their person.
